MAIONESE BRAZILIAN POTATO SALAD

This potato salad seems lighter than the American version in my opinion, and is great eaten chilled on a hot day. Use the olives of your choice, but kalamata would be too strong. You can substitute many vegetables with frozen defrosted ones to save time. Where I said "1/3 cup" I mean a handful, but recipezaar did not like that, so 1/3 cup it is.

Steps:

  • Rinse the potatoes, cube, boil until tender but not mushy.
  • Peel and dice the carrots, cook until tender.
  • Chop the green beans (I use frozen, defrosted, precooked ones) to size preferred. Place in bowl with cooked carrots, add defrosted peas and diced palm hearts(You can get them at specialty stores, and Trader Joes and Cost Plus often carry them) and olives.
  • To the bowl, now add your potatoes, oil, onion, salt, pepper, and parsley. Slowly fold in the mayonnaise, you may not need all of it as it is to taste.
  • The salad does not taste incredible right after mixing, you will need to let it set in the fridge, covered, until cool, or even overnight.

4 -5 large potatoes, peeled
2 carrots
1/3 cup green beans
1 cup peas
10 olives, diced
1/3 cup hearts of palm, chopped
1 (12 ounce) jar mayonnaise
1 tablespoon chopped green onion
1 dash olive oil
1 pinch chopped parsley (optional)
salt and pepper

MAYONNAISE- BRAZILIAN POTATO SALAD

Mayonnaise? Really? Really, I am not kidding. This is what Brazilians call their potato salad and it is absolutely delicious! It was the first Brazilian recipe I learned 'way back in 1990. Steps:

  • 1. Peel and cut the potatoes. Cut them into cubes, slightly larger than cubed hash browns and more rectangular. Put them in a pan and boil until just done, but they don't lose their shapes. Drain, set aside and let cool. Do the same with the carrots. Each pan should not boil for more than ten minutes. Check them for 'doneness' (not mush) before removing from heat.
  • 2. Take the peppers, cut off one of the sections from each color of pepper. Slice each about 1/8th inch wide slices, then cut them into 1/8x1/4 inch rectangular cubes. Put them in a mixing bowl and set aside. Take the olives, drain them, and slice, add them to the mixing bowl. Add about five dashes of salt, mix everything very well. Check for cooled potatoes and carrots.
  • 3. The potatoes and carrots should be cooled by now. Add them to the pepper/olive combination, mix well, add the mayonnaise. Combine everything so each piece is well-coated. Add the corn. Mix well. Serve cold.

4 medium white potatoes
2 medium carrots
1 small red bell pepper
1 small yellow bell pepper
5 dash(es) salt
2 c mayonnaise
1/2 jar(s) green olives
1/2 c corn, drained

BRAZILIAN POTATO SALAD

This recipe was given to me by my best friend who lived in Brazil for a while. Its a great barbecue side dish or potluck dish. *Measurements are approximate and are to taste* I personally like more lemon than stated below. This salad is supposed to be a little tart.

Steps:

  • Cut potatoes in medium wedges and cook in salted water until done, but not smooshy soft.
  • Drain.
  • Put cooked potatoes into a bowl, while still hot, squeeze lemon over them (I'm estimating it at 1/2 to a whole lemon so add incrementally and taste); stir.
  • Let cool.
  • Meanwhile chop up celery and green onion.
  • Once cooled add the mayonnaise,add celery and green onions, then shaved carrot stalk with a vegetable peeler, Stir until mixed but do not over stir or potatoes will become mushy.
  • Add salt and pepper to taste.
  • Refrigerate for at least 1 hour to let the flavors meld.

1 lb red potatoes (regular potatoes will suffice)
1 green onion
1/4 limes or 1/4 lemon
3 tablespoons mayonnaise
1 stalk celery
1/2 carrot, grated
salt and pepper
